The Vega Group, the civil protection association of the Valnure-Valchero Union, has found a new leader in Andrea Foroni, who also volunteers for the organization. In addition to his work with the Vega Group, Foroni is the vice-president of Team Sporty Dogs, a sports association registered with CONI that specializes in training and working with dogs. The group has recently taken over a large green area, a former rugby field, that had been abandoned for decades. With permission from the Municipality, the group has completely redeveloped the area for their own use.
In just two years, Team Sporty Dogs has grown from six members to 90, with five technical instructors who are recognized by the National Educational Sports Center (Csen) and the Organization for Sports Education (Opes). Each instructor balances their work with their passion for training sporting dogs, a task that they describe as demanding but immensely satisfying.
